Yes I had forgot about that ,the 2 pieces of wood go on the top to help hold the FW in place .Add them after the throttle wire and tank is completed otherwise there in the way .
What I did for length was to measure the cowl length ,by setting it spinner end up on a table and measuring thru the hole.Then I subtracted 1/2"and came up with 9 inches for a reference . That gave me approx 5/8" overlap on the FW for mounting .

Just for kicks and extra strength I added some extra support to the FW It maybe dosent need it ,but I don't like the thought of it giving at all.
